1. Accessibility and Efficiency:
Among major cause of the extensive selling point of on-line poker is its accessibility. In contrast to brick-and-mortar casinos, internet poker platforms provide players the freedom to try out at any time, anywhere. With a stable internet connection, poker lovers can enjoy a common online game without leaving their domiciles, eliminating the need for vacation. Also, on-line poker web pages supply many options, including various variations of poker, tournaments, and different risk amounts, catering to players of all skill amounts.

5. Challenges and Drawbacks:
While on-line poker brings many benefits, it is really not without its challenges. Among major downsides may be the prospect of fraudulent activities, including collusion and processor chip dumping, where people cheat to gain an unfair benefit. However, reputable online poker platforms employ powerful safety steps and Highstakes login random quantity generators to thwart such behavior. Also, some people might find the absence of actual cues and interactions which can be section of live poker games a disadvantage, as they can be harder to see opponents and employ mental techniques online.
